Understanding Invisible Dog Fencing: More Than Just a Wire
Invisible dog fencing, also known as electronic or wireless dog fencing, has revolutionized pet containment. It’s a system designed to keep your dog within designated boundaries without the need for a traditional physical fence. This innovative solution relies on a combination of components: a transmitter, a receiver collar worn by your dog, and a boundary wire (for wired systems) or a wireless signal (for wireless systems).

How Invisible Fences Work: A Technical Overview
The core concept involves creating a virtual boundary that your dog learns to respect. When your dog approaches the boundary, the receiver collar emits a warning tone. If the dog continues past the warning zone, the collar delivers a static correction, designed to be unpleasant but harmless. Through consistent training, your dog associates the tone and correction with the boundary, learning to stay within the designated area. It’s crucial to emphasize that proper training is paramount for the success of any invisible fencing system. According to leading experts in animal behavior, positive reinforcement techniques, combined with consistent boundary training, are essential for ensuring your dog’s well-being and understanding of the system.

Delving into PetSafe’s Invisible Fence Features
PetSafe invisible fence systems are packed with features designed to provide effective and humane pet containment. Here’s a detailed look at some of the key features:
- Adjustable Correction Levels: PetSafe collars offer multiple levels of static correction, allowing you to customize the intensity based on your dog’s temperament and training progress. This ensures that the correction is sufficient to deter your dog without causing undue stress or anxiety.
- Run-Through Prevention: This feature automatically increases the correction level if your dog attempts to run through the boundary, providing an extra layer of security. This is particularly useful for dogs with high prey drive or those prone to escaping.
- Waterproof Receiver Collar: PetSafe collars are designed to withstand the elements, ensuring reliable performance even in wet conditions. This allows your dog to enjoy outdoor activities without compromising the effectiveness of the fence.
- Wire Break Alarm: For wired systems, a wire break alarm alerts you immediately if the boundary wire is cut or damaged, preventing your dog from escaping. This feature provides added peace of mind, knowing that you’ll be notified of any potential issues.
- Digital Display: Many PetSafe transmitters feature a digital display that allows you to easily monitor the system’s status and make adjustments as needed. This user-friendly interface simplifies the setup and maintenance process.
- Expandable Coverage: PetSafe systems can be expanded to cover larger areas by adding additional wire or adjusting the signal range, accommodating growing properties or multiple dogs.
- Training Mode: The training mode allows you to introduce your dog to the system without delivering a static correction, focusing on positive reinforcement and familiarization. This is a crucial step in ensuring your dog’s comfort and understanding of the boundaries.
Unlocking the Benefits: Why Choose an Invisible Fence?
The advantages of using an invisible fence extend far beyond simply containing your dog. These systems offer a range of benefits for both you and your furry friend:
- Freedom and Flexibility: Invisible fences allow your dog to enjoy greater freedom within your yard without the constraints of a traditional fence. They can run, play, and explore without feeling confined, promoting their physical and mental well-being.
- Aesthetic Appeal: Unlike traditional fences, invisible fences don’t obstruct your view or detract from your property’s curb appeal. This allows you to maintain an open, inviting outdoor space while still ensuring your dog’s safety.
- Cost-Effectiveness: Invisible fences are often more affordable than traditional fencing options, especially for large properties. The installation process is typically less labor-intensive, resulting in lower overall costs.
- Customizable Boundaries: Invisible fences allow you to create custom boundaries that conform to your specific property layout and landscaping features. You can easily exclude areas such as gardens, pools, or driveways, providing tailored protection for your dog and your property.
- Portability: Some wireless systems are portable, allowing you to take them with you when traveling or camping, providing a familiar and secure environment for your dog wherever you go.
- Reduced Maintenance: Unlike traditional fences, invisible fences require minimal maintenance. There’s no need to paint, repair, or replace sections, saving you time and money in the long run.
- Improved Dog Behavior: With proper training, invisible fences can help improve your dog’s behavior by establishing clear boundaries and expectations. This can reduce unwanted behaviors such as digging, jumping, and escaping. Cons:
- Requires Consistent Training: The system’s effectiveness relies heavily on proper training and reinforcement.
- Battery Replacement: The receiver collar requires periodic battery replacement, which can be an ongoing expense.
- Potential for False Corrections: Although rare, interference or signal fluctuations can occasionally cause false corrections.
- Not Suitable for All Dogs: Invisible fences may not be suitable for dogs with certain medical conditions or behavioral issues.
